Massive time and cost savings
Higher Instagram posting cadence requires constant new visuals. Previously, that meant hiring designers or hunting stock photos — slow and expensive.
- Designer: ¥5,000–50,000+ ($35–350) per image, multi-day turnaround.
- Stock photos: Monthly subscription + time spent hunting.
- Midjourney: From $10/month with unlimited generation, high-quality output in minutes.
I often need 20+ images a month, and Midjourney has cut my image production time by ~80% while keeping costs in the $30–50/month range. That freed hours for content planning and analysis.

Midjourney prompt principles for Instagram
Generating great Instagram visuals with Midjourney comes down to prompt quality. Understand these principles and quality jumps.
Be specific to convey intent
AI produces unwanted output from vague prompts. Be explicit about:
- Subject: e.g., "smiling woman," "coffee cup," "minimalist workspace"
- Style: e.g., "watercolor," "photorealistic," "anime," "industrial design"
- Color and mood: e.g., "pastel colors," "warm tones," "bright," "muted"
- Composition and angle: e.g., "close-up," "overhead," "portrait," "full body"
- Background: e.g., "bokeh background," "city skyline," "sun-lit room"
- Quality and texture: e.g., "high detail," "cinematic," "matte texture"
Example: A smiling young woman holding a latte art coffee cup, natural light, cozy cafe interior, soft bokeh background, warm color tone, photorealistic, high detail --ar 4:5
Optimize aspect ratio
Instagram has recommended aspect ratios. Use Midjourney's --ar parameter.
- Square:
--ar 1:1(default feed) - Portrait:
--ar 4:5(highest screen real estate on feed) - Landscape:
--ar 1.91:1(less recommended; special use)
For feed I lean heavily on --ar 4:5; for Reel thumbnails I'd want --ar 9:16 (though that's better-suited to video than image generation). Portrait images draw eyes and tend to lift engagement.
Negative prompts
To exclude unwanted elements, use the --no parameter.
- Example:
--no text, watermark, blurry, deformed hands
To avoid common AI artifacts like awkward fingers and garbled text, --no deformed hands, ugly hands, extra limbs, bad anatomy, text, watermark is essentially mandatory.

Commercial-use considerations and risks for Instagram
Using Midjourney visuals commercially on Instagram has important considerations. I always verify rules and legal posture carefully.
Midjourney terms and copyright
Midjourney-generated images are generally owned by the user — but only for paid plan users. Free-plan images cannot be used commercially.
Midjourney retains rights to use your generated images. They may appear as references for other users or in Midjourney promotion. Avoid generating anything genuinely private or highly confidential.
Similarity and trademark risk
AI learns from massive internet data and can unintentionally generate visuals close to existing brand logos, characters, or specific artist styles.
Before commercial use, I always run Google reverse image search and trademark database checks manually. Avoid prompts that evoke famous brands or characters or use them with extreme care. Trademark infringement can become a real legal issue.
Personality rights and publicity rights
Midjourney can generate images that closely resemble real people, which raises personality- and publicity-rights issues. Putting celebrity names in prompts is absolutely off-limits due to infringement risk.
Even with non-celebrity generated images, exercise care for commercial use. If an image "clearly looks like a specific person," don't use it.
Tips and pitfalls for getting the most out of Midjourney
Tips
1. Iterate until you find a consistent style
Brand world matters on Instagram. Pin certain prompts and parameters (e.g., --style raw, --stylize 250) for consistent tone. Spend real time finding the style that fits your brand.
2. Use Vary and Remix to refine
If the first generation isn't right, "Vary (Strong)," "Vary (Subtle)," and "Remix" produce variations quickly. Remix especially helps when you want to change a specific part of an image.
3. Combine with other image editors
Midjourney is strong but rarely perfect in one shot. Polish with Canva or Photoshop — add text, color tweaks, remove unwanted elements.

Pitfalls
1. Vague prompts get vague results
"Stylish photo" produces unpredictable output. Literal Japanese-to-English translations are especially risky. Build the habit of writing detailed, specific English prompts.
2. Don't over-expect; embrace variability
AI isn't perfect every time. Expect to generate multiple and pick the best, or use Vary to refine.
3. Not verifying commercial-use status
As above, failing to check copyright, trademark, and personality-rights status can spiral. Always insert verification when going commercial.
4. Risk of "AI-generated" being obvious
AI images can show unnatural details (fingers, garbled text, unreal objects), creating a "this is AI" perception that erodes trust.
- Fix: Use negative prompts like
--no deformed hands, ugly hands, extra limbs, bad anatomy, text, watermarkaggressively. - Fix: Touch up unnatural areas in an image editor post-generation.
- Fix: Lean into "AI-generated" labeling for entertainment value — that strategy works too.
